商家入驻
发布需求

掌握AutoSAR基础软件技能,开启高效汽车软件开发之旅

   2025-07-06 9
导读

AutoSAR(汽车系统架构和软件包)是汽车电子领域的一种标准,它定义了车辆软件的架构、组件和接口。掌握AutoSAR基础软件技能对于从事汽车软件开发的人来说至关重要,因为它确保了软件的可移植性、互操作性和标准化。以下是一些关于如何开始掌握AutoSAR基础软件技能的建议。

AutoSAR(汽车系统架构和软件包)是汽车电子领域的一种标准,它定义了车辆软件的架构、组件和接口。掌握AutoSAR基础软件技能对于从事汽车软件开发的人来说至关重要,因为它确保了软件的可移植性、互操作性和标准化。以下是一些关于如何开始掌握AutoSAR基础软件技能的建议:

1. 学习AutoSAR架构:了解AutoSAR的基本概念,包括硬件抽象层(HAL)、操作系统抽象层(OAL)和中间件抽象层(MIDL)。这些层次为车辆软件提供了一种模块化和分层的方法,使得开发者可以专注于特定的功能而不必关心底层细节。

2. 熟悉AutoSAR组件:AutoSAR包含一系列预定义的组件,如网络通信、实时时钟、传感器数据管理等。通过阅读文档和示例代码,你可以了解这些组件的功能和使用方法。

3. 学习AutoSAR编程模型:理解AutoSAR的编程模型,包括类、方法、消息传递和事件驱动编程。这将帮助你编写符合AutoSAR规范的代码,并与其他系统组件进行交互。

4. 实践AutoSAR开发:通过实际项目来应用你所学的知识。你可以使用AutoSAR提供的仿真工具或模拟器来测试你的代码,或者在真实的汽车项目中进行开发。

掌握AutoSAR基础软件技能,开启高效汽车软件开发之旅

5. 参加培训课程:有许多在线和离线的AutoSAR培训课程可供选择。这些课程通常由经验丰富的专家授课,可以帮助你快速掌握AutoSAR的核心概念和技术。

6. 加入社区:参与AutoSAR社区,与其他开发者交流经验和技巧。你可以在GitHub上找到许多开源项目,其中包含了AutoSAR相关的代码和文档。此外,你也可以参加AutoSAR会议和研讨会,与行业专家面对面交流。

7. 持续学习和更新:汽车软件技术不断发展,新的标准和规范不断出现。因此,你需要保持对最新技术的敏感性,并定期更新你的知识和技能。

通过以上步骤,你可以逐步掌握AutoSAR基础软件技能,开启高效汽车软件开发之旅。记住,成为一名优秀的汽车软件开发者需要时间和经验积累,但只要你坚持不懈地学习和实践,你一定能够取得成功。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-2449486.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

130条点评 4.5星

办公自动化

简道云 简道云

0条点评 4.5星

低代码开发平台

帆软FineBI 帆软FineBI

0条点评 4.5星

商业智能软件

纷享销客CRM 纷享销客CRM

0条点评 4.5星

客户管理系统

悟空CRM 悟空CRM

113条点评 4.5星

客户管理系统

钉钉 钉钉

0条点评 4.6星

办公自动化

金蝶云星空 金蝶云星空

0条点评 4.4星

ERP管理系统

用友YonBIP 用友YonBIP

0条点评 4.5星

ERP管理系统

唯智TMS 唯智TMS

113条点评 4.6星

物流配送系统

蓝凌EKP 蓝凌EKP

0条点评 4.5星

办公自动化

 
 
更多>同类知识
推荐产品 更多>
唯智TMS
  • 唯智TMS

    113条点评 4.6星

    物流配送系统

蓝凌MK
  • 蓝凌MK

    130条点评 4.5星

    办公自动化

简道云
  • 简道云

    0条点评 4.5星

    低代码开发平台

纷享销客CRM
蓝凌低代码 帆软FineReport
 
最新知识
 
 
点击排行
 

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部